Warez
Intellectual property (IP) that is distributed illegally. Examples are software being given away or resold without the permission of the author, serial numbers or ways to crack software that is sold (serialz or crackz), movies, music, etc.

Oh my it works!!!!! I got sound!! I did a happy dance around the office, they think this old lady really lost it now.
Here's how it had to be done (for anyone else).
Use dvd2avi. Once you have the avi and ac3 files then get AVIMux Gui which will bring the two together.
